SOMECA 640 (TD) specs: key facts
The SOMECA 640 (TD) was built from 1973 to 1982.
The SOMECA 640 (TD) has a claimed engine power (gross or net not stated) of 47.1 kW (63.2 hp); it has no measured PTO figure.
The SOMECA 640 (TD) was offered in two-wheel-drive and four-wheel-drive versions.
The SOMECA 640 (TD) has a FIAT-IVECO 8045.02.200/307 engine, a 4-cylinder 3.46 L diesel unit.
The SOMECA 640 (TD) weighs 2,125 kg (4,685 lb) unladen.
The SOMECA 640 (TD) has a rear PTO running at 540 rpm.
The three-point hitch of the SOMECA 640 (TD) lifts 1,830 kg (4,034 lb) at the lower-link ends.

What engine is in a 640 (TD)?
A 640 (TD) has a FIAT-IVECO 8045.02.200/307, a 4-cylinder 3.46 L diesel engine.
| Make & model | FIAT-IVECO 8045.02.200/307 |
|---|---|
| Cylinders | 4, liquid-cooled |
| Displacement | 210.9 ci · 3.46 L |
| Max torque | 162 lb·ft · 219 N·m |
| Electrical system | 12 V |

How much does a 640 (TD) weigh?
A 640 (TD) weighs 4,685 lb (2,125 kg) unladen.
| Unladen weight | 4,685 lb · 2,125 kgTD: 2,600 kg |
|---|---|
| Wheelbase | 81.5 in · 2,070 mmTD: 2,110 |
| Length | 138.6 in · 3,520 mm |
| Width | 67.5 in · 1,715 mm |
| Height | 93.3 in · 2,370 mm |
| Ground clearance | 17.5 in · 444 mmTD: 374 |
| Front track | 52.0–79.3 in · 1,320–2,015 mmTD: 1,420 |
| Rear track | 47.8–75.4 in · 1,215–1,915 mmTD: 1,420-2,020 |
| Turning radius, braked | 11.2 ft · 3.42 mTD: 4,300 |
